What muscles are involved with facial expression?

A

occipitofrontalis: Raises eyebrow and wrinkles forehead (furrows the brow)
Corrugator supercilii: Connects frontal bone to skin of eyebrow, draws eyebrow inferiorly and medially.
Orbicularis oculi: Serves to close the eye.
Levator palpebrae superioris: Elevates upper eyelid.
Nasalis: Flares nostrils
Levator labii superioris: Elevates upper lip.
Orbicularis oris: Closes lips, kissing/pucker of lips.
Zygomaticus major and minor: Draws angle of mouth up and out for smiling/laughing.
Platysma: “tense neck” appearence.
Masseter: Chewing
Temporalis: chewing
Pterygoids: Side-side chewing
Buccinator: “milkshake muscle”

Extrinsic eye muscles?

A
Superior rectus: Moves eyeball upward
Inferior rectus: Moves eyeball downard
Medial rectus: Moves eyeball inward
Lateral rectus: Moves eyeball outward
Superior oblique: Downward and outward
Inferior oblique: Upward and outward.

What is the sternocleidomastoid muscle?

A

Origin: Sternum and clavicle

Inserts at temporal bone (mastoid process), causes head and neck flexion

Muscles used in breathing?

A

External intercostals: Pulls each rib upwards to increase lung volume
Internal intercostals: Pulls each rib down to decrease lung volume.

What is the sartorius?

A

Longest muscle in body, “Tailors muscle”. Flexes, abducts, laterally roates thigh.
Origin: Illium
Insertion: Winds around knee, inserts on tibia.
